DUMAGUETE 13 November 2024 - The latest session of the Training and Research Outreach (TRO) Program of the Foreign Service Institute (FSI) was hosted by the Consular Office (CO) in Dumaguete last 5 November 2024. At the request of CO Dumaguete headed by Ms. Kristine Marie M. Cruz-Mamigo, the TRO session covered discussions on human trafficking, immunities and privileges, and protocol practices. The 4-hour session was handled by FSI Director General Francisco Noel R. Fernandez III.
Participants in the training session included personnel from CO Dumaguete and officials from the local offices of the Department of Education (DepEd), Philippine National Police (PNP), Philippine Statistics Authority (PSA), Department of the Interior and Local Government (DILG), and Oriental Negros Emergency Rescue Foundation (ONE Rescue).
The TRO Program was initiated by FSI in order to respond to the training requests it received from Consular Offices of the Department of Foreign Affairs (DFA) situated outside of Metropolitan Manila. Upon the recommendation of the requesting CO, the training session may be opened to personnel of other government agencies in the locality in order to maximize the number of beneficiaries of the capacity building program provided by FSI. To date, personnel from the Consular Offices in Iloilo City; Angeles, Pampanga; and Dumaguete have availed of the training sessions offered by FSI under its TRO Program since it was initiated on 17 October 2024.
FSI is the training and research agency of the DFA which was created under Presidential Decree No. 1060 and whose remit was expanded under Republic Act No. 7157. The FSI Board is chaired by the Secretary of Foreign Affairs, with the Chairperson of the Civil Service Commission (CSC), Director General of FSI, President of the University of the Philippines (UP), and President of the Development Academy of the Philippines (DAP) as members.
